WebAn upper motor neurone (UMN) lesion will be in the central nervous system (brain and spinal cord). On neurological examination, typical signs of an upper motor neurone lesion include: Disuse atrophy (minimal) or contractures. Increased tone (spasticity/rigidity) +/- ankle clonus. WebThe mechanics of making a diagnosis. Making a diagnosis involves comparing what you know about the causes of a symptom and the diagnostic criteria for each cause to what you find during your clinical assessment of the patient through the application of diagnostic reasoning. This is known as the mechanics of diagnosis (Figure 1). WebTurner syndrome is a chromosomal disorder affecting females where one X chromosome is missing. The classical features of Turner syndrome are short stature and delayed puberty.
